What is Sarsys AB Accounts Receivable?

Accounts Receivable are created when a customer has received a product but has not yet paid for that product. Sarsys AB's accounts receivables for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was kr5.64 Mil.

Accounts receivable can be measured by Days Sales Outstanding. Sarsys AB's Days Sales Outstanding for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was 44.53.

In Ben Graham's calculation of Net-Net Working Capital, accounts receivable are only considered to be worth 75% of book value. Sarsys AB's Net-Net Working Capital per share for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was kr-2.33.

Sarsys AB Accounts Receivable Calculation

Accounts Receivable is money owed to a business by customers and shown on its Balance Sheet as an asset.


Sarsys AB Accounts Receivable Explanation

1. Accounts Receivable are created when a customer has received a product but has not yet paid for that product. Days Sales Outstanding measures of the average number of days that a company takes to collect revenue after a sale has been made. It is a financial ratio that illustrates how well a company's accounts receivables are being managed.

Sarsys AB's Days Sales Outstanding for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as:

Days Sales Outstanding
=Accounts Receivable/Revenue*Days in Period
=5.642/11.562*91
=44.53

2. In Ben Graham's calculation of Net-Net Working Capital (NNWC), Sarsys AB's accounts receivable are only considered to be worth 75% of book value:

Sarsys AB's Net-Net Working Capital Per Share for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as:

Net-Net Working Capital Per Share
=(Cash And Cash Equivalents+0.75 * Accounts Receivable+0.5 * Total Inventories-Total Liabilities
-Preferred Stock-Minority Interest)/Shares Outstanding (EOP)
=(1.047+0.75 * 5.642+0.5 * 9.637-38.256
-0-0)/12.088
=-2.33

Be Aware

Net receivables tells us a great deal about the different competitors in the same industry. In competitive industries, some attempt to gain advantage by offering better credit terms, causing increase in sales and receivables.

If company consistently shows lower % Net receivables to gross sales than competitors, then it usually has some kind of competitive advantage which requires further digging.

Average Days Sales Outstanding is a good indicator for measuring a company's sales channel and customers. A company may book great revenue and earnings growth but never receive payment from their customers. This may force a write-off in the future and depress future earnings.

Sarsys AB formerly SARSYS-ASFT AB is a developer and manufacturer of Continuous Friction Measuring Equipment and provider of cutting-edge ITS and Road/Runway Weather Information System. ASTF products include Volvo XC60/V90 Friction Tester, VW Sharan Friction, Skoda Octavia Friction, T-5 Trailer Friction, and T2GO Friction Tester. SARSYS products include Sarsys Volvo Friction Tester (V90), Sarsys Opel Friction, Sarsys Friction Tester Transporter, and Sarsys Trailer Friction Tester. The products include computerized technology for monitoring factors such as friction, freezing points, early ice warning-systems, precipitation, groundfrost, ice deposit growth, camera-surveillance systems among others.
